oracle中监听程序当前无法识别连接描述符中请求服务 的解决方法 🚀
在使用Oracle数据库时,有时会遇到监听程序无法识别连接描述符中请求服务的问题,这通常表现为ORA-12504错误。别担心,以下是一些简单的解决步骤,帮助你快速解决问题!💻
首先,检查`listener.ora`文件,确保其中的SID_DESC配置正确。例如,你的配置可能类似如下:`(SID_DESC = (GLOBAL_DBNAME = your_db_name)(ORACLE_HOME = /path/oracle_home)(SID_NAME = your_sid))`。记得保存后重启监听器:`lsnrctl stop`和`lsnrctl start`。
其次,确认`tnsnames.ora`文件中的连接描述符是否正确。比如:`(D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= your_host)(PORT = 1521))(CONNECT_DATA = (SERVICE_NAME = your_service_name)))`。
最后,测试连接。可以使用SQLPlus输入`connect username/password@your_service_name`验证。如果问题仍未解决,请检查防火墙设置或联系Oracle支持团队。💼
希望这些步骤能帮你顺利解决问题,享受流畅的数据库操作体验!✨
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。